i've half had an(electrical) oil temp gauge fitted to my car, but have had mixed opinions on where the sender should be placed. i first had the wrong size adapter and purchased a larger one. what i over looked was that the adapter was for a ready made bung hole above cylinder 3, but the subaru garage had been trying to fit it as a sump plug adapter(so the adapter i had was still too small). subaru have argued that the sump is the best place to get an accurate reading because thats where the oil sits at all time. the supplier who sold me the gauge and 'cylinder 3' adapter says that i'll get a truer reading from the cylinder bung hole as it is the hottest area???
to be fair, the supplier is going out of his way to enable me to have a sump plug modified (if i want it placed there), but this will take time to organise, but will be hopefully free of charge.
opinions on this would really be appreciated. i'm having the car tek3 mapped in a couple of weeks and realise the importance of an accurate oil temp reading so i want it all sorted by then.

true reading from the no3 plug as it sits the sender in the oil gallery on the hottest running cylinder due to the location of the turbo..... the sump plug is not ideal as it will show a lower reading due to the fact that some cooling of the oil will occure because of the airflow around the sump

from what has been said above does anyone on here have their oil temp read from the sump. the most popular view i get is that the hottest temp from the oil gallery is needed, but i don't i want to know whether the oil is being cooled properly? hence get the reading from the sump.
checking the cooling ability of the oil is not the main function of the gauge...... you need to know how hot the oil gets during hard use because oil is rated at specific temperatures..... should the oil exceed the upermost temp reccomended then it begins to loose its lubricating qualities...... not much point it being there after that and then engine failiure occures .....part of its function is to take heat away from the hot bits as it circulates through the system...... it will cool well by the time the sender in the sump reads it,but you wont know the highest temp it has reached.... this is vitally important and should not be overlooked

I run mine in the sump as I have a pressure gauge in No.3.
I get a steady 85 degree's with normal driving.
However if you have an earlier car without the plastic undertray, you will see lower values due to airflow cooling under the car. With the undertray in place the sump seems fairly protected, as I found out when I ran for a while without the undertray.

you can do both as i have temp and pressure above no.3. the reason for temp been above no.3 is so you know the max temp at all times as to me there is no point knowing average temp as the whole point of having an oil temp is knowing when to back off when it gets too hot.
so say for example my back off point is 100 and yours with sump temp is a 100 now my engine will be a max of 100 were as yours will be 115 max temp at your 100 reading. this is why most pick no.3 as its much safer to know your max temp as the average serves no purpose!

On track I've been seeing 130oC with the Defi sender above No.3, I back off at this point
If the sender were in the sump, that high temp would be masked.
It's a lot easier to fit the sender to the sump plug than to No3, maybe why it's a favourite location for some?

True that #3 is where it's hottest (where my temp sender is too), but the sump temp is the temp of the oil that is supplied to the bearings.
Either would be fine by me. My main concern would be viscosity lowering due over temperature of oil that is getting supplied to the bearings.
